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 12 and 72 is 72
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 72 - For the 1st fraction, since 12 × 6 = 72,
60/12 = 60 × 6/12 × 6 = 360/72 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 72 × 1 = 72,
90/72 = 90 × 1/72 × 1 = 90/72 - Add the two like fractions:
360/72 + 90/72 = 360 + 90/72 = 450/72 - 450/72 simplified gives 25/4
- So, 60/12 + 90/72 = 25/4
